Product Description:
The Ekolu Pua print pays tribute to the three flower tradition of Hawaii. This is our signature sun protection hoodie, built for paddlers who spend real hours on the water and need gear that performs without excuses.
Every yard of this hoodie contains 13 recycled plastic bottles pulled from the waste stream. Not a marketing gimmick. Just the right way to make ocean gear.
Why paddlers choose this hoodie:
SPF 50 protection woven directly into the fabric, not sprayed on. Thumb holes that protect the backs of your hands when you need them, fold away when you do not. Button closure hood fits over your cap or visor for dawn patrol sessions. Flatlock stitching throughout so you never deal with chafing during long paddles. Loose flowing fit moves with your stroke instead of against it.
Fabric:
78% recycled polyester, 22% spandex. Moisture wicking. Quick dry. Designed and tested on Maui. Made in USA
